Unggai Bena, Eastern Highlands, Papua New Guinea

Overview

Unggai Bena, set in the cool lush region of Eastern Highlands, Papua New Guinea, is a rural district famous for its fertile valleys and strong community traditions. Travelers are drawn by the unique blend of local culture, scenic landscapes, and immersive village life.

Best Time to Visit

May to September for drier weather and cooler temperatures.

Local Tips

Mobile coverage and internet may be limited, prepare accordingly. Cash is preferred at most local establishments, and ATMs can be scarce.

Cultural Etiquette

Dress modestly, especially in villages and around elders. Always greet locals politely; asking permission before photographing people is expected. Tipping is not common practice.

Safety Warnings

Petty theft can occur in markets and transport stations. Avoid walking at night in isolated areas and seek local advice before exploring remote villages.
